the long version

"On August 29, 2005, Hurricane Katrina blew into the Gulf of Mexico wreaking havoc on the Gulf Coast and Louisiana. Our roof blew off and rainwater spilled in the house. Furthermore, the levees broke, and flood water filled our home. We evacuated on August 28th to Baton Rouge, Louisiana and Houston, Texas for three weeks. We moved thirteen times before we called Encinitas, California home. We always wanted to move to California. However, we didn't think the universe would answer through the means of a hurricane."--Amazon.com description.
